**Handover: Contrast audit — Lanternly dashboard**

I've finished the color-contrast pass on the Lanternly dashboard through the reports section. Remaining work: settings pages and the empty-state illustrations, which fail at small sizes. Flagged items use the audit spreadsheet's severity column; anything marked P1 blocks the Q3 accessibility milestone. Marza has context on the token remapping approach if questions come up. Full findings and screenshots are on the page below.

runbook for hahap-baduf: https://jira.qorvelsys.internal/projects/projects/pages/projects/c0cb

## Formula Sandbox Data Stores

Hey plugin folks! When your users type custom formulas into a Quillgrid sheet, we never run them raw. Each formula gets evaluated inside the Hatchbox sandbox, which strips file access, network calls, and anything spicy. Results are cached in the sandbox-results store so repeated evaluations stay cheap. Your plugin can read cached results but never write directly. To inspect the cache locally, connect to the sandbox-results database using the connection string below.

primary connection of yagep-kahip = redis://giliel_svc:zYiKsLL2PLpfPL@db-348f.xolmarsys.corp:5432/fenwyn

## Service Accounts — Consent Banner Rollout

The Noticeboard consent banner ships config from the internal Flagroom service. One service account per environment; staging and prod are not interchangeable. The rollout job reads its credential at deploy time and fails closed if missing. Do not reuse this account for analytics pulls. Rotation is handled by the platform team quarterly. The current staging credential is below.

app token of bahaf-tajeg = zpat23_SjjsllwiLmXbtS65veZaV47

**Alert: DIGEST_SCHEDULE_DRIFT**

The Quillmere batch digest scheduler has missed its dispatch window by more than 15 minutes. Subscriber digests may arrive late or duplicate on the next run. Check the Quillmere cron worker queue depth and the lock table for stale leases. Do not manually re-trigger without clearing the lease, or duplicates will be sent. If the drift exceeds one hour, escalate to the messaging team at the address below.

alerts address for kajog-tadup: druox@plorvanet.internal